排序
Vant Popup組件內三個div出現(xiàn)縫隙是什么原因?
vant popup組件內出現(xiàn)縫隙的排查與解決 在使用Vant框架的Popup組件時,三個div(例如:cp-coupon-dialog_header、cp-coupon-dialog_list、cp-coupon-dialog_footer)即使設置了相同的寬度(578p...
如何讓input的高度變高但文字位于底部?
讓input高度變高,文字底部對齊的技巧 網(wǎng)頁設計中,經常需要調整表單元素樣式,例如:設置較高的input框,同時讓文字位于底部而非居中。本文將介紹一種無需padding的巧妙方法。 假設現(xiàn)有HTML結...
HTML元素布局:父元素、元素本身和子元素如何共同影響網(wǎng)頁排版?
html元素布局:父元素、自身及子元素的協(xié)同作用 網(wǎng)頁開發(fā)中,HTML元素布局至關重要。本文深入探討HTML元素布局,闡明父元素、元素自身及子元素如何相互作用,共同影響網(wǎng)頁排版。 我們以常見的嵌...
CSS垂直外邊距合并:如何理解及避免其帶來的布局問題?
css垂直外邊距:合并機制及解決方案 CSS中,垂直外邊距的合并行為常常讓開發(fā)者頭疼。它并非簡單的疊加,而是會發(fā)生合并,最終結果小于各個元素外邊距之和。本文將深入探討垂直外邊距合并的機制...
如何實現(xiàn)橫向U型步驟條組件?
自定義橫向U型步驟條組件的構建 在網(wǎng)頁開發(fā)中,常常需要創(chuàng)建不同形狀的步驟條來滿足特定需求,例如本文討論的橫向u型步驟條。本文將探討如何構建這樣的組件。 挑戰(zhàn) 許多開發(fā)者尋求現(xiàn)成的組件或C...
如何讓不同背景色的元素保持一致寬度?
如何讓不同背景色的元素寬度一致? 很多前端開發(fā)者都遇到過這個問題:頁面上兩個元素,分別帶有紅色和藍色背景,但寬度不一。如何讓它們寬度一致?尤其當元素寬度非固定值時,問題更棘手。下圖...
負邊距在某些情況下為何未生效?如何解決這個問題?
CSS負邊距失效原因及解決方案 在網(wǎng)頁布局中,負邊距(negative margin)常用于實現(xiàn)元素重疊等特殊效果。然而,它有時會失效,本文將分析其原因并提供解決方案。 案例分析 假設一個包含主容器(main...
Vue.js動態(tài)樣式應用:如何根據(jù)布爾值正確修改元素內邊距?
Vue.js動態(tài)樣式:巧妙運用CSS選擇器解決內邊距修改難題 在Vue.js開發(fā)中,動態(tài)調整元素樣式是常見需求。本文將解決一個關于根據(jù)布爾值動態(tài)修改元素內邊距的難題。 問題描述: 開發(fā)者試圖通過綁定...
Vant Popup組件內三個div出現(xiàn)縫隙:是什么CSS樣式導致的?
Vant Popup組件內三個div出現(xiàn)縫隙的排查指南 在使用Vant框架的Popup組件時,經常會遇到一個問題:Popup組件內包含的三個結構和樣式相同的div之間出現(xiàn)意外的縫隙。本文將分析此問題,并提供排查...
如何讓不同背景色的元素保持一致的寬度?
如何讓不同背景色的元素保持一致的寬度? 網(wǎng)頁設計中,常遇到需要并排顯示不同背景色元素,且寬度一致的問題。 由于內邊距(padding)或邊框(border)等樣式差異,實際顯示寬度可能不一致,造成視...
父元素有padding,如何讓絕對定位子元素寬度等于父元素內容區(qū)域寬度?
當父元素設置了padding屬性,而子元素采用絕對定位(position: absolute)時,如何使子元素寬度精確匹配父元素內容區(qū)域(排除padding)的寬度? 這個問題的核心在于:絕對定位元素的width: 100%;...